Taylor Swift and fellow teenage popstar Miley CyrusCountry’s sweetheart Taylor Swift has no intention to be a Hollywood wild child.

The “Love Story” singer says going clubbing and drinking alcohol doesn’t interest her unlike many other stars her age:

“I’ve been given the freedom to do whatever I want. I’m 19 - if I want to storm out of the house and go to a club and get drunk and take my clothes off and run naked through Nashville, I can do that. I just really would rather not. It’s as simple as that. It’s not like I’ve been beaten down by some corporation that’s forcing me to always behave myself - I just naturally do. Sometimes people are fascinated by the fact that I don’t care about partying, almost to the point where they think it’s weird. I think when we get to the point where it’s strange for you not to be stumbling around high on something at 19, it’s a warped world.”

Taylor also says she is getting revenge on the girls who used to bully her at school by writing songs about them.

“I would go to school and not have anyone to talk to, but what I could look forward to was going home and writing something about it. There’s where the revenge of writing a song about someone who’s means to you started. If you’re horrible to me I’m going to write a song about you and you are not going to like it. That’s how I operate.”
